摘 要:本文介绍了厚膜混合集成电路国内外发展现状。通过对军品多品种、小批量订单特点进行系统分析,识别出订单的变量要素,通过将订单划分不同的阶段,识别出多个订单不同阶段的共性内容,以此为基础,探索建立一种MOTS(Military-off-the-shelf:军用货架即定制或者开发的军用货架)体系。通过调整部分交付条件实现了对军品复杂订单的大批量交付。并在中国电科某研究所进行了实践探索。This paper introduces the development status of thick film hybrid integrated circuit in domestic and foreign country. Through systematic analysis on the characteristics of military products and small batch orders, the production factors of orders were identified. Divided by the order of different phases, identify multiple orders at different stages of common content, on this basis, to establish a system of MOTS (Military-off-the-shelf: military spot can be customized or developed for military spot). The bulk delivery of military orders is achieved by changing partial delivery conditions. In addition, a practical exploration was carried out in a research institute of CETC.
